I run Windows 7 on my current PC and recently have had this issue come up, it is constant, and I am at a loss now for fixes...
Whenever I put the computer into sleep mode, or click shut down, it refuses to stay asleep/shut down. Once it cycles through the sleep/shut down command, it looks good to go, then a milisecond later, the CD/DVD-Rom player makes a wierd noise, green light on the DVD-ROM Drive lights up, and then the computer turns back on fully... EVERY TIME...
I have tried a clean boot, to no avail. I have also tried updating the CD/DVD-ROM's drivers, its up to date. I have used the windows troubleshooter too, and have had no luck at all.
Any help/input is much appreciated. Here are basic info on my system:
MAIN: Asus M4A87TD/USB3
Chipset: AMD RD770
Processor: AMD Phenom II x 4 840 @3.2GHz
Memory: 6GB DDR3 SDRAM
Vid Card: GeForce GTX 460
Hard Drive: Seagate ST31000524AS ATA Device 1TB
CD/DVD Drive: Generic? It doesnt show any specs when I look it up
OS: Windows 7 Home Edition 64bit
